Throughout Africa, PENDANTS OF VARYING INTRICACY, material, symbolism,
and meaning reflect individual cultures and regions. PENDANTS AND
CHARMS ARE NOT ONLY A WAY OF “dressing up” and feeling elegant,
but also indicate one’s status, bring good fortune, and protect
their owners. Examine the complex designs of the various jewelry and
metal objects on exhibit before creating a piece of your own.
